Getting A Business Loan After A Bankruptcy

Navigating bankruptcy as an entrepreneur isn’t the end; it’s a new beginning. Securing a business loan afterward requires resilience and planning. Understanding how bankruptcy affects creditworthiness is key—it can complicate future loans but isn’t insurmountable. Steps like assessing finances, crafting a strong business plan, and rebuilding credit are crucial. Additionally, building relationships with lenders, offering collateral, and staying transparent throughout the process enhance loan prospects. Despite challenges, securing a business loan post-bankruptcy is achievable and marks progress toward entrepreneurial success.
